Résumé

A non-equilibrium (NEQ) model including heterogeneous reaction is developed. Mass transfer rates are described using Stefan-Maxwell equations. In a first section, model equations are described. Then the resolution strategy is presented in more details. In the third section, an illustrative example is considered: acetic acid esterification. The system is solved and results are presented: molar liquid fraction profiles in the column. Those results are compared to those obtained with a more classical model (equilibrium model): fraction profiles are quite different. Reaction rates are influenced by this variation.
